I've got Hot-Spot deployments where I'm seeing 80% 2.4GHz and 20% 5GHz. I would have thought by now that most devices support 5GHz and that would become the predominant spectrum. For those that are doing hot-spots with dual-bands, what do you see in spectrum use? Rory Conaway * Triad Wireless

My 7 year old tablet has 5GHz. Some devices will cling to the 2.4 band for whatever reason. Band-steering helps. It works most of the time on the Cambium E400 and 500's we've deployed. Some devices are just assholes. On 2/5/2017 11:19 PM, Rory Conaway wrote: I�ve got Hot-Spot deployments wh
